What is Facebook’s Libra all about?

News of Facebook entering the blockchain universe with the cryptocurrency it co-founded with the Libra association has spread like wildfire. Libra, that’s what they’re calling the coin, is a proposed virtual currency said to run on a permissioned blockchain. It is said to be a means of payment between people across the globe similar to the likes of PayPal and Venmo. 


Purpose

Its vision is to empower the part of the world that does not have bank accounts by enabling peer-to-peer transactions. For the storage of this currency, Facebook has developed Calibra, a wallet app. The wallet is expected to launch in 2020 with its own app and even on platforms such as Whatsapp and Messenger. 

Calibra will allow its users to send, receive, and store Libra securely. The main attribute that makes Libra appeal to the crowd is the lack of transaction fees charged when it is exchanged although there is a sum charged to use the currency. 

Trust 

Trust is a major issue that the coin will face because of Facebook’s tainted history of neglecting user privacy. They would need to work really hard to provide a coin that ensures security and privacy of transactions is upheld.

Is it a cryptocurrency?

It is still under question whether Libra is actually a cryptocurrency or a digital currency. Its structure differs quite a bit from popular c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ether. Libra is said to be more stable when compared to other cryptocurrencies. The future of this coin and where it will go is not yet predictable.
